Drizzle both days, but not a washout — temps are sitting at 23–25°C and most of the rain is light. The Burlington Waterfront Festival runs all weekend at Spencer Smith Park and is worth the damp shoes. If you'd rather stay dry, the Art Gallery of Burlington has a free open studio Sunday afternoon and the Model Railway Club is indoors Saturday. Plan around the weather, not against it.

Burlington Waterfront Festival

The Burlington Waterfront Festival takes over Spencer Smith Park on Saturday — free admission, live music, food vendors, and artisan stalls along the lake. Drizzle is forecast but the festival runs rain or shine. Go before noon if you want parking without a hike.

The Enchanted Garden at the RBG

The Enchanted Garden at RBG Rock Garden runs Sunday 9 a.m. to 3 p.m. and is built for kids aged 4 to 8. Children follow a self-guided discovery trail through the garden — costumes encouraged, so dust off the fairy wings. Adults must accompany kids; check RBG's site for ticket details.

Burlington Model Railway Club Public Demonstration

Burlington Model Railway Club opens its Hidden Valley Park layout Saturday 11 a.m. to 3 p.m. — N-scale and HO-scale trains run indoors, G-scale garden railway runs outside if the drizzle cooperates. Free admission, donations welcome. Good rainy-day backup for train-obsessed kids.

Free Family Open Studio at the AGB

The Art Gallery of Burlington runs a free Family Open Studio Sunday 1–4 p.m., inspired by artist Roda Medhat's sculptural installation. Artist-instructors are on hand but kids can also work independently. Fully indoors and free — solid Sunday option if the drizzle picks up.

Burlington Farmer’s Market

Burlington Lions Club Farmers Market runs Saturday 8 a.m. to 2 p.m. at Burlington Centre. Local produce, baked goods, honey, and artisan goods. Get there before 10 a.m. for the best selection and before the drizzle settles in.

Royal Duck Bounce Park

Royal Duck Bounce Park is set up inside Burlington Centre through August 2 — massive inflatable park, open Saturday 10 a.m. to 8 p.m. Parent/child bundles start at $34.99. Book ahead; spots are limited and this is the obvious wet-weather call for under-10s.
